    Quote Originally Posted by RAM Engineer View Post
    Soooo.....

    I just picked up one of these. What is the recommended height Larue mount for a T1?
    SCAR front sight looks big through every optic I've put on mine, including full-sized Aimpoint. I've tried various heights for Aimpoint Micro, and came to conclusion that I'd prefer to run mine with front sight down. With that, the height of Aimpoint mount is dictated by personal preference; I use a tall one.
